Output 31fdf642d1b01b879251d67ced9b11bcbf404b8338f633a4081e5cd2b2d77cce:0

value
306047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6417e540ee1a72db1b58518ea7280db71240f9c4 OP_EQUAL
address
3ApG81vfyaQM14L2qP9mKfhBkPRyn1wakZ
transaction
31fdf642d1b01b879251d67ced9b11bcbf404b8338f633a4081e5cd2b2d77cce
confirmations
72404
spent
true